So, I was in a battle and I came across this Faelora and it says it's rare but it has no visibles (unless I'm just not seeing it) so why is this rare?

It has multiple carries. The rarity isn't based on vis, it's based on GP. So it has multiple carries. You would have to use a scanner, or catch it and test it, to find out what it has. :)

Also, (sorry) but what is GP?

GP is Genotype points. You will see these change in the generator when you create a new pet using essences.

Every carry on a pet is 1 GP
Every visible is 2gp.

So in the new pet fighting system, assume the following -

(common) White Star - 0 GP (no carries or vis)
(uncommon) Green Star - 1 GP (1 carry)
(rare) Blue Star - 2 GP (1 vis OR 2 carries)
(epic) Purple Star 4 GP (2 vis OR 4 carries, OR 1 vis + 2 carries)
(legendary) Orange Star - 5 GP (2 vis + 1 carry OR 1 vis + 3 carries OR five carries)
(mythical) Red Star - 6 GP (3 vis, OR 2 vis + 2 carries, OR 1 vis + 4 carries, OR 6 carries)

You can encounter those pets at any level but keep in mind that the more GP they have, the rarer and harder to find they will be. In almost a year here I have run into only two red star pets and a small handful of orange star pets.

Also, to catch an orange or red star pet, you must have a red trap, which can be obtained from the diamond shop, or bought off other players. They are quite expensive.

The number of stars indicates how strong they are. Their stats are higher if they have more stars. :)
